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into significant problems. Professionals typically examine the surface for signs of damage, such as cracked or missing shingles, blistering, or granule loss, as well as checking for areas where the roof may be vulnerable to leaks or structural stress. These inspections often include evaluating flashing, vents, and other roof penetrations to ensure all components are properly sealed and functioning. Regular inspections help property owners maintain the integrity of their roofs and extend their lifespan by catching minor concerns early.
One of the primary benefits of asphalt roof inspections is addressing problems that can lead to costly repairs or premature roof replacement. Over time, weather exposure, aging, and debris accumulation can cause damage that may not be immediately visible from the ground. Inspections help uncover issues such as water intrusion, damaged underlayment, or deterioration of shingles, which can compromise the roof’s ability to protect the building. Identifying these issues early allows property owners to plan maintenance or repairs proactively, minimizing the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ration.

Inspection Fees - Typical costs for an asphalt roof inspection range from $150 to $300. These fees often cover a thorough assessment of the roof’s condition and potential issues.
Additional Services - Some providers may charge extra for detailed reports or recommendations, with prices varying from $50 to $200. Costs depend on the inspection’s scope and complexity.
Factors Affecting Cost - The size and height of the roof can influence inspection prices, which generally range from $200 to $500 for larger or more complex roofs. Location and accessibility also impact the overall cost.
Cost Variability - Prices for asphalt roof inspections can vary widely based on the local market and service provider, with typical ranges from $100 to $400. It is advisable to contact local pros for precise est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should an asphalt roof be in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to identify potential issues early.
What are common signs of asphalt roof damage? Signs include missing or cracked shingles, curling edges, granule loss, and visible leaks or water stains inside the property.
Why is an asphalt roof inspection important? Regular inspections help detect problems early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the roof's lifespan.
What does an asphalt roof inspection typically include? Inspectors evaluate shingle condition, flashing, gutters, ventilation, and check for signs of wear or damage.
